All Are Welcome

We welcome all people committed to liberal religion and embrace the principles of freedom, reason, and tolerance in pursuit of their individual paths. You do not need to be a Unitarian or Universalist to join.

Our members include Unitarians, Universalists, and other religious liberals throughout North America and the world.

Our members include both individuals and organizations, like congregations, churches, fellowships, and other related groups.

NAUA requires no adherence to any theological creed as a basis for membership.
